- `background` (_color_, **required**): background color, in
_rgba_. Thus, in the example above, the background is set to _black_
- `monitor` (_string_): monitor to place the bar. If not specified,
the primary monitor will be used.
- `left-spacing` (_int_): space, in pixels, added **before** each module
- `right-spacing` (_int_): space, in pixels, added **after** each module
